Reseña del libro "Born to Die"

Skye Adams is starting her Sophmore year in high school, and like many other girls in her small Northern California town, she has dreams of becoming a famous Hollywood Actress. Although she was recently diagnosed with Kidney disease which prevents her from leading a normal life and knowing the chances of success in Hollywood are slim, her biggest obstacles are her low self-esteem and severe social anxiety. Too embarrassed to even admit her dreams to anyone, she feels she will never be able to make the change within herself that will give her the courage she needs to go after her dream. The town seems stagnant with nothing to offer, that is until Jesse Steele; a new guy from L.A. arrives and takes an immediate interest in Skye. After a few chance encounters, she cannot deny their strong connection, and she finds his ambitious nature and positive attitude to be infectious. Skye immerses herself into Jesse's wild world of racing and running around with the Branson Gang. Although her parents disapprove of him and see him as no good, Skye knows this is not true. As they become closer, they admit their love for one another and become inseparable. Jesse's love for Skye is proven when he risks his own life to give her a new one. Now, Skye can go after her lifelong dream, but because of Jesse's involvement with the Branson gang, it may be too late.
